Output 29ab628e959f52a393f7f8c9ab9f5bbf9835959999d5bcd6f8c47bafb83b14e6:11

value
1115000
script pubkey
OP_0 OP_PUSHBYTES_20 e84afc84f2996b2e9e17804e37bb11ff4370deaa
address
bc1qap90ep8jn94ja8shsp8r0wc3laphph42200p9x
transaction
29ab628e959f52a393f7f8c9ab9f5bbf9835959999d5bcd6f8c47bafb83b14e6